The Seattle Seahawks, fresh off yet another playoff victory, will travel to Atlanta to take on the Falcons in the NFC’s Divisional round, with a trip to the NFC title game on the line. It’s a rematch of one of this season’s best games, and a rematch of Russell Wilson’s first playoff loss.
Outside of the story lines, it’s a terrific match-up between one of the NFL’s best defenses and the best offense in the league. A dominant run defense against an all-time single season running back tandem. A top-2 wide receiver against a top-2 cornerback. Vic Beasley against Garry Gilliam. Yes, you can go down a list of titan-clashes on the horizon, and it begins on Saturday afternoon.
Battle of the birds, with both hungry for revenge. And just 180 minutes to Super Bowl glory.
The Facts
Location: Georgia Dome, Atlanta, Georgia
Game time: Saturday, January 14th at 1:35 PM PST
TV Channel: Q13 FOX (Seattle) (Full List of TV stations for PNW) (Do I get the game?)
Online streaming: NFL Game Pass
Radio: 710 ESPN Seattle (Steve Raible, Warren Moon) Full Radio List
Matchup history: The Seahawks lead the all-time series, 10-6.
Last time: The Seahawks came out victorious in a game-of-the-season candidate, a 26-24 thriller in Seattle.
Odds: The Falcons are 3.5-point favorites.
Announcers: Kevin Burkhardt, John Lynch
Referee: Gene Steratore
